Ok ok, we all hate Joe Lieberman for his unabashed support of this abortion of a war and his Brutus-like turn on the party that has backed him all these years. But there is one thing that Joementum can do to redeem himself: Serve as John McCain's Vice Presidential nominee. It will spell certain doom for McCain and ensure that Obama will be elected president and the war will not go on for 100 years.
As we all know, putting Joe on the ticket in 2000 was the biggest mistake Al Gore ever made. He was a horrible campaigner and brought absolutely nothing to the ticket. He is about as charismatic as a nauseous eel, was a tired and lazy campaigner and was such a bad a debater that he somehow managed to lose to Dick Cheney. He was poison to the ticket.
If he was on the republican ticket, he'd bring all of those great faults with him while bringing with him a whole new mess of liabilities. McCain is very weak with social conservatives, and appointed a socially moderate democrat to be next in line would make the heads of right wingers who are already holding their noses just completely explode. And Joementum is so fearless in his defense of the Iraq War, it would further emphasize how in-line McCain is with the Bush-policy on Iraq. Not to mention: he wouldn't deliver Connecticut or any other state for that matter. And there will be NO democrats who decide to cross-over because Joementum's on the ticket. All he will do is lose McCain votes.
